Question 36 (Mandatory) (2.5 points) Carmelita Inc., has the following information available: Costs from Costs from Beginning Inventory $2,500 6,200 Current Period $22,252 150,536 Direct materials Conversion Costs At the beginning of the period, there were 500 units in process that were 60 percent complete as to conversion costs and 100 percent complete as to direct materials costs. During the period 4,500 units were started and completed. Ending inventory contained 340 units that were 80 percent complete as to conversion costs and 100 percent complete as to materials costs. (Assume that the company uses the FIFO process cost method. Round cost per unit figures to two cents, i.e. $2.22 when calculating total costs.) The total costs that will be transferred into Finished Goods for units started and completed were $161,775 $156,960 $162,855 $161.505
